aicep Portugal Global – Trade & Investment Agency | Foreign Direct Investment in Portugal Increases

Foreign direct investment in Portugal was 180,411 million euros in 2023, 6.24% more than in 2022, with Lisbon receiving more than half, according to data from the Bank of Portugal (BdP). The statistics on foreign direct investment in Portugal (FDI) by region, analyse the amounts of this investment by beneficiary Portuguese region. Ogletree | European Union Digital Services Act: New Regulations Apply

The European Union Digital Services Act (DSA) now applies to all digital “intermediary services” that provide users with access to online goods, services, and content. The DSA took effect on November 16, 2022, and regulates a wide range of aspects such as transparency, safety, targeted advertising, and liability for illegal content. Berkowitz Pollack Brant Advisors + CPAs | Are you Ready for Tax Changes Ahead?

Many of the taxpayer-friendly provisions of the tax code introduced by the Tax Cuts and Jobs Act (TCJA) in 2017 are scheduled to expire at the end of 2025, exposing individuals and businesses to the prospect of significantly higher tax liabilities beginning in 2026.
